When walking into a GP surgery, private clinic, or outpatient facility, the reception desk is the first point of contact. Medical receptionists manage patient bookings, answer urgent queries, handle administrative records, and calm anxious visitors.

 However, because they sit on the frontline of healthcare delivery, receptionists are also the most exposed to patient frustration, behavioral distress, and unpredictable safety incidents. While customer service training and clear signaling help mitigate everyday friction, physical security measures remain essential. Among these, a silent panic button directly linked to internal clinical areas is one of the most vital, yet frequently overlooked, safety tools in modern healthcare practice management.

The Evolving Security Landscape in Healthcare Facilities

In recent years, healthcare facilities across the globe have reported a noticeable rise in verbal abuse and physical aggression directed at front-of-house staff. Patients visiting a clinic are often dealing with physical pain, long wait times, distressing diagnoses, or mental health crises. These factors can quickly turn a routine interaction into a high-volatility event. Because receptionists are usually positioned behind a desk without immediate physical barriers, they bear the initial burden of a patient's emotional outburst.

Relying solely on external emergency services or off-site security personnel is rarely sufficient when an aggressive confrontation begins. Police response times, while swift for high-priority calls, can still take critical minutes during an active confrontation. Having a localized, instant alert system bridges the immediate gap between the onset of trouble and the arrival of support, protecting both staff members and other waiting patients from potential harm.

Silent Alarms vs. External Security Signals

Traditional panic buttons installed in commercial settings often alert an external monitoring center or sound a loud, localized siren. In a medical clinic, however, both of these approaches have significant drawbacks:

  • Auditory Sirens: Triggering an audible alarm in a waiting area full of stressed patients often worsens panic, elevates tension, and causes the aggressor to act out unpredictably.

  • External-Only Dispatch: Calling off-site security guards or remote monitoring hubs can result in delays, while remote personnel may lack familiarity with the facility's internal layout.

  • Direct Clinical Alerts: Connecting the panic button directly to internal clinical workstations, nurse stations, and consultation rooms allows nearby staff who know the facility to react instantly.

By keeping the alert silent to the aggressor but immediate to internal colleagues, clinical staff can intervene within seconds rather than minutes.

The Unique Advantage of Interconnecting with Clinical Areas

Linking a reception panic button directly to doctors, nurses, and clinical supervisors creates an immediate, multi-tiered response network within the building. Clinical personnel possess unique advantages during a front-of-house emergency:

  • De-escalation Expertise: Healthcare professionals are routinely trained in conflict resolution, psychiatric triage, and de-escalation techniques suitable for distressed or confused patients.

  • Immediate Witness and Backup: The physical arrival of an additional authority figure, such as a lead GP or senior nurse, frequently causes an aggressive individual to stand down without further confrontation.

  • Rapid Medical Intervention: If a situation is caused by a medical emergency, such as severe disorientation, hypoglycemia, or a acute mental health episode, clinical staff are already on-site to provide immediate medical assistance.

This seamless connection ensures that administrative personnel are never left isolated during unpredictable or dangerous workplace incidents.

Key Operational Benefits of Integrated Alert Systems

Implementing a silent duress alert system linked directly to clinical areas offers several operational benefits for healthcare facilities:

  • Discreet Activation: Receptionists can trigger the alarm using hidden foot pedals, under-desk buttons, or discreet desktop key combinations without drawing attention from the aggressive individual.

  • Location-Specific Notifications: Modern IP-based panic systems can display exact notification pop-ups on doctor and nurse screens (e.g., "URGENT: Main Reception Desk Silent Alarm Activated"), directing help exactly where it is needed.

  • Customizable Escalation Protocols: Facilities can configure systems so that pressing a button notifies adjacent consultation rooms first, followed by a secondary alert to facility security if not acknowledged within thirty seconds.

  • Enhanced Workplace Morale: Staff members perform their duties with greater confidence and lower anxiety when they know an instant safety net is active at all times.

Bridging Technology with Comprehensive Staff Training

While physical security systems provide a reliable safety net, technology alone cannot solve workplace safety challenges. A panic button is only as effective as the protocols supporting it and the training of the person sitting behind the desk. Front-of-house staff must know precisely when to de-escalate a situation verbally and when an issue has crossed the line into a security risk requiring button activation.

Investing in structured professional development equips front-line staff with the situational awareness needed to recognize early warning signs of aggression, communicate clearly during high-stress encounters, and execute emergency protocols efficiently. Implementation Best Practices and Facility Protocols

To ensure that panic alarm systems connected to clinical areas remain effective and reliable, healthcare administrators should observe several implementation best practices:

  • Conduct Regular Hardware and Software Tests: Perform routine, scheduled tests of panic buttons outside of patient hours to confirm that screen pop-ups and notifications reach all connected clinical terminals.

  • Establish Clear Standard Operating Procedures (SOPs): Every clinician must know what action to take when an alert appears on their screen—whether that means sending a designated responder or immediately calling emergency services.

  • Ensure Multiple Activation Points: Place panic triggers at various accessible locations around the reception area, including check-in pods, back-office desks, and triage counters.

  • Review Incident Reports Continuously: Analyze every activation event to refine response protocols, improve receptionist de-escalation tactics, and update practice security guidelines.
